Sometimes people have more confidence in me than I have in myself.
Example.....
On a Wednesday night I was working in the nursery at our church.
I had seven children and I was all alone. Two ladies walked in (Pam and Jesse) and we had this conversation:
Pam: Hi Kirsty!
Me: Hi!
Pam: How is it going? I can send someone in here to help you if you want me to.
Jesse: Oh, she's fine, she has two younger brothers and two younger sisters; she's used to it.
Pam: Okay
And then they leave.
I was speechless.
I was far from fine, I was in way over my head!
At one point a little boy (Zane) decided he wanted to be a dinosaur and threw a bunch of goldfish on the floor and started stomping on them! He said they were little
people and he was crushing them.
Needless to say, I ended up vacuuming after service.
Jesse seemed to have a lot more confidence in me than I had in myself.
I think I need to have a lot more confidence in me too.
